Released
Not Available
0.5818
en
Alien Death Machine
(4)
Rating
2.6
Release Date
1999-02-16
Run time
90min
A meteor falls to earth near a secret CIA military hideout and merges with a motorcycle and it's rider to create an alien soldier bent on recovering an alien artifact..